Kent State University at Geauga — ROI, Cost & Payback

Public · Burton, OH · 1,601 students

The verdict

Kent State University at Geauga charges a net price of $12,044/yr after aid — a 2-year total of $24,088. Median earnings ten years after entry are $45,388, below the $48,360 high-school baseline, so on this institution-wide metric the degree does not clear its cost. Program choice is what changes that. The arithmetic, on Kent State University at Geauga's own numbers. Net price $12,044 × 2 years = $24,088 total. Median earnings $45,388 fall $2,972 short of the $48,360 high-school baseline, so the premium this formula divides by is not positive and no break-even year exists on institution-wide pay. A programme here earning $58,360 would clear the $24,088 bill in about 2.4 years — the gap, not the price, is what blocks payback. Full method.

How much debt do Kent State University at Geauga students graduate with?

A median $24,500 in federal loans among completers, or 54% of the $45,388 its graduates earn ten years out — our math. The figure excludes private loans and students who left before finishing.

What share of Kent State University at Geauga students graduate?

20% finish their degree — 80% leave carrying the cost without the credential. Spread the $24,088 bill across that completion rate and the cohort pays $120,440 per graduate produced — our math, and the figure a payback number never shows.

Is Kent State University at Geauga expensive compared with other Ohio colleges?

Its $12,044 net price runs $7,739 below the $19,783 median across the 144 Ohio colleges we profile, and $15,477 less across the full degree.
